Felicia Williams's Net Worth
Felicia Williams's net worth is estimated to be at least $397,148.63 as of 11/23/2024. CoreStreet's estimation of Felicia Williams's net worth is based on their sale of stock and current holding of stock.
Felicia Williams is SVP at Macy’s Inc. They have executed at least 7 trades of stock as per SEC Form 4 filings. Their most recent trade was for 202 units of M stock on 04/07/2020. Their biggest sale was on 03/02/2018 when they sold 10,000 units of Macy’s Inc stock for $294,200.00. They typically trade 1 times per year.
Total value of insider buys:
- $11,175.50
Total value of insider sells:
- $385,973.13
Most recent insider trade:
- April 7, 2020
Felicia Williams's Insider Trading History
Macy’s Inc | Title | Amount | Price | Type | Total Value |
---|---|---|---|---|---|
April 7, 2020 | SVP | 202 | $6.20 | Sell | $1,252.40 |
March 23, 2020 | SVP | 422 | $4.92 | Sell | $2,076.24 |
April 8, 2019 | EVP | 671 | $25.69 | Sell | $17,237.99 |
March 28, 2018 | EVP | 785 | $28.99 | Sell | $22,757.15 |
March 2, 2018 | EVP | 10,000 | $29.42 | Sell | $294,200.00 |
March 29, 2017 | EVP | 1,697 | $28.55 | Sell | $48,449.35 |
Meridian Bioscience Inc | Title | Amount | Price | Type | Total Value |
---|---|---|---|---|---|
March 16, 2020 | Director | 1,550 | $7.21 | Buy | $11,175.50 |